Buy a Mini English Bulldog
The AKC does not recognize the Mini English Bulldog as a distinct breed or size. However there are other clubs and organizations which do.
These dogs love their owners, especially children. They form an instant bond with their humans and do not like being left to themselves for long periods of time.
They have trouble breathing in humid and hot temperatures due to their snouts being short. They need a cool and air-conditioned environment.

Health
Bulldogs are sturdy and durable dogs, but they are susceptible to health issues like hip dysplasia, heart diseases, respiratory problems, and tracheal collapse. Regular brushing is essential due to their short muzzles and small mouths, making them more susceptible to dental diseases. They also are prone to overheating, so make sure you exercise them in cooler times of the day.

Mini bulldogs don't have the same energy as other breeds, and they can be bored quickly It's therefore important to invest time in training them from a young age to ensure they are well-behaved and obedient. They are well-suited to rewards-based training and prefer positive reinforcement. If you're not sure where to begin, it's a good idea to enroll in a puppy obedience class to teach basic commands and socialization. These classes can cost anywhere from $50 to $125 for the series. Additionally, you'll need to budget for grooming sessions ($30 to $60) as well as other dog-related expenses like toys, leashes, and collars.
